Output 624be9448515a81f40ac0ede131a8ad1aef1f5a1d8633b7f3650a5b39ab4b92e:0

value
1592531
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2464dbeb2f397ad3d51418f03bbe7087700b809 OP_EQUALVERIFY OP_CHECKSIG
address
1MdRw97BL5brgQrHgnaWHc6TrDquqiVpRr
transaction
624be9448515a81f40ac0ede131a8ad1aef1f5a1d8633b7f3650a5b39ab4b92e
spent
true